10 sentences on Gateway Of India for kids (set #1) The Gateway of India is a famous monument in Mumbai. It was built in 1924 by the British. This structure is made from yellow basalt and concrete. The design of the Gateway of India is a mix of Indian and Arabic styles. It is located at the waterfront, facing the Arabian Sea.

Gateway of India is an arch-monument built in the early 20th century in the city of (Bombay), India. It was erected to commemorate the landing of King-Emperor George V, the first British monarch to visit India, in December 1911 at Strand Road near Wellington Fountain. The gateway is also the monument from where the last British troops left India in 1948, following Indian independence. Gateway of India History The gateway was built to commemorate the arrival of George V, Emperor of India and Mary of Teck, Empress consort, in India at Apollo Bunder, Mumbai (then Bombay) on 2 December 1911 prior to …The Gateway of India is a monument built during the British Raj in Mumbai (formerly Bombay), India. [2] It is located on the waterfront in the Apollo Bunder area in South Mumbai and overlooks the Arabian Sea. [3] [4] The structure is a basalt arch, 26 metres (85 feet) high. The Gateway of India is one of India's most unique landmarks situated in the city of Mumbai. The colossal structure was constructed in 1924. Located at the tip of Apollo Bunder, the gateway overlooks the Mumbai harbor, bordered by the Arabian Sea in the Colaba district. Jan 17, 2018 · Gateway of India Timings, Entry Fee and Best Time to Visit. It opens 24 hours for the public and can be visited by the visitors at any time of the day. Entry is completely free for everyone. The camera is also allowed here without paying any extra charges. It is located in the big area and at least 1 hours is required to see this monument from ... The central arch of the monument stands at 26 meters (85 feet) and is adorned with intricate latticework and decorative motifs. Flanked by two large turrets, the Gateway has a regal aura that captivates visitors.
